Why export_decision_record needs a policy

Exporting a record is a read/retrieval operation that serializes existing data into a file format (Markdown or JSON). While it writes a file locally, the primary action is reading/exporting existing decision record data without modifying the source data. Severity is low as misuse would only result in local file creation.

Can I rate-limit export_decision_record?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the export_decision_record r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block export_decision_record complet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for export_decision_record.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
